Pros: For a Software Engineer, the base salary here is pretty solid for a tech startup in San Francisco. We do get unlimited PTO, which is a nice perk, and there's a 401k match available. The hybrid work model helps with flexibility too.
Cons: Health insurance plans are tough; high deductibles really eat into your wallet. The equity grants felt pretty low for a company at this stage. You can't really count on significant bonuses either, which kinda stings.
Advice to Management: Re-evaluate health insurance plans to offer more competitive options. Consider increasing the equity pool for employees to make compensation packages more attractive.
